Ordinals
beta
Sat 930783396219952
decimal
186156.3396219952
degree
0°186156′684″3396219952‴
percentile
44.323018916372106%
name
hghyfctyben
cycle
0
epoch
0
period
92
block
186156
offset
3396219952
timestamp
2012-06-25 09:03:21 UTC
rarity
common
prev
next